by Paul Strathern (Author)
Leonardo da Vinci, Niccol Machiavelli, and Cesare Borgia--three iconic figures whose intersecting lives provide the basis for this astonishing work of narrative history. They could not have been more different, and they would meet only for a short time in 1502, but the events that transpired when they did would significantly alter each man's perceptions--and the course of Western history.
Paul Strathern has lectured in philosophy and mathematics and is a Somerset Maugham Prize-winning novelist. He is the author of two series--Philosophers in 90 Minutes and The Big Idea: Scientists Who Changed the World--Napoleon in Egypt, and the Sunday Times bestseller The Medici: Godfathers of the Renaissance. He lives in London.
